I. General formats
- The FCE Reading test includes 7 sections with total 52 questions &
takes 75 minutes

- The “Reading” and “Use of English” sections are combined into one
exam paper. This means you will only have around 10 minutes to
answer all the questions in each part.

- If you want to achieve level B2, for Reading you must score minimum
of 24 points and over 28 points in Use of English test.

- Length of texts: about 2,200 words to read in total. Texts may be


from newspapers & magazines, journals, books (fiction & non-fiction),
promotional and informational material.

III. How to score Reading & Use of English
1.READING
skills in FCE
The exam paper has seven parts and for the
reading portion we have to look just at parts 1,
5, 6 and 7.

• Reading counts 20% toward your overall


result.
• For parts 1 and 7, you get 1 mark and for
parts 5 and 6, you get 2 mark for each
correct answer.
• There is a total of 42 possible marks in this
part.
2. USE OF ENGLISH
You will calculate your score for Use of English
from parts 2, 3 and 4.

Use of English counts 20% toward your overall


result.

For parts 2 and 3, you get 1 mark and for part 4,


you get up to 2 marks for each correct answer

There is a total of 28 possible marks in this part.
